What it does
What
Education/trainingThe Advancement Of Health Or Saving Of LivesWho
Children/young PeopleElderly/old PeoplePeople With DisabilitiesThe General Public/mankindHow
Provides Advocacy/advice/informationSponsors Or Undertakes ResearchActs As An Umbrella Or Resource BodyCharitable objects
THE ADVANCEMENT OF EDUCATION, THE RELIEF OF SICKNESS AND THE BENEFIT OF THE PUBLIC IN ORDER TO PROMOTE A BETTER UNDERSTANDING OF AFFECTIVE DISORDERS AMONG PROFESSIONALS AND THE PUBLIC; TO IMPROVE THE RECOGNITION AND TREATMENT OF AFFECTIVE DISORDERS LEADING TO BETTER HEALTH OUTCOMES; TO PROMOTE EDUCATION AND RESEARCH INTO THE AFFECTIVE DISORDERS.
Governing document: MEMORANDUM AND ARTICLES OF ASSOCIATION INCORPORATED 2 FEBRUARY 2004.
